The Two Main Plans: Starter vs. Unlimited
GoHighLevel offers two primary plans for individual businesses. For a local service business, one is the clear choice.
Starter — $97/month This plan is ideal for businesses automating their own operations. It includes the full CRM, sales pipeline management, two-way SMS and email, Missed Call Text Back, unified inbox, appointment scheduling, Automation workflow builder, website/funnel builder, and reputation management. Crucially, GoHighLevel doesn't charge more for contacts or users, a rare and valuable feature at this price point.
Unlimited — $297/month The Unlimited plan is for marketing agencies reselling the software, offering white-labeling, full API access, and client sub-accounts. If you're a service business owner focused on streamlining your own operations, the Starter plan is sufficient.
An Agency Pro plan at $497/month exists for large marketing agencies with advanced features like a branded mobile app, but it's not relevant for local service businesses.
What GoHighLevel Replaces: The Real Cost Savings for Your Business
The $97/month GoHighLevel pricing isn't the most important number. What truly matters is the total cost of tools it replaces. Most local service businesses pay for a fragmented software stack that GoHighLevel can consolidate, simplifying operations and reducing integration headaches.
Imagine a dental practice in Austin, Texas, juggling separate CRM, email, appointment, and review software. They pay a premium for each, and their team wastes time on integrations. GoHighLevel offers a unified solution, often at a fraction of the combined cost.
| Tool Being Replaced | Typical Monthly Cost | Why GoHighLevel Wins |
|---|---|---|
| CRM (e.g., HubSpot Starter, Pipedrive Essential) | $50–$800/month | GoHighLevel's robust CRM handles lead tracking, customer communication, and pipeline management all in one place. |
| Email Marketing (e.g., Mailchimp, ActiveCampaign Lite) | $30–$150/month | Built-in email marketing with advanced automation capabilities means you don't need a separate platform. |
| SMS Marketing (e.g., Twilio, SimpleTexting) | $25–$100/month | Two-way SMS communication is native, allowing for seamless lead engagement and appointment confirmations. |
| Appointment Scheduling (e.g., Calendly, Acuity Scheduling) | $15–$45/month | Integrated calendars and booking pages simplify scheduling for both you and your clients. |
| Review Management (e.g., Birdeye, Podium) | $200–$400/month | Automated review requests and reputation monitoring help you build social proof without extra tools. |
| Landing Page/Funnel Builder (e.g., ClickFunnels, Leadpages) | $97–$297/month | Create high-converting landing pages and sales funnels directly within the platform. |
| Total Potential Savings | $417–$1,792/month | At $97/month, GoHighLevel often pays for itself several times over by consolidating your tech stack. |
For businesses spending $300-$500/month on a few tools, GoHighLevel offers immediate efficiency and capability upgrades, saving money and providing a powerful, integrated system.
What's Not Included: Understanding GoHighLevel's Usage-Based Costs
While GoHighLevel pricing is competitive, it's not an all-inclusive flat fee. Usage-based costs for certain features are pass-through expenses at near-wholesale rates, ensuring you only pay for what you use and keeping the base subscription affordable.
SMS and Email Sending: SMS and email are billed separately via Twilio and Mailgun. A small plumbing business sending 500 SMS messages monthly might pay $7–$15 extra. 10,000 emails typically add $1–$2. These competitive rates are often lower than direct contracts.
Phone Calls: The built-in phone system bills calls per minute at standard Twilio rates (approx. $0.013/minute inbound, $0.014/minute outbound). An HVAC company with 200 calls monthly would pay $5–$8 extra. This small cost provides invaluable integrated call tracking and recording.
AI Features: GoHighLevel offers powerful AI capabilities like an AI chatbot and Conversation AI (formerly Voice AI Agent) for automated lead engagement. These add-ons are billed based on usage. Implementing Conversation AI to qualify leads 24/7 means paying per interaction or minute. This allows leveraging cutting-edge technology without hefty upfront costs, scaling AI usage as needed. The AI chatbot handles website inquiries, while Conversation AI engages leads by phone, qualifies them, and books appointments.
For most local service businesses, the total all-in cost, including usage fees, typically falls between $110–$150/month. This is still far less than separate tools, providing a more integrated and efficient system.
The 14-Day Free Trial: Your Risk-Free Test Drive
GoHighLevel offers a 14-day free trial, no credit card required. This essential window allows you to evaluate the platform. GoHighLevel has a learning curve, and the trial gives you time to set up your first automation, connect your phone, and test critical features like Missed Call Text Back. You need to see its impact firsthand.
During your trial, you get full Starter plan access. Import contacts, build a sales pipeline, and run a live test of an automated follow-up. For example, if a potential client calls your roofing business while you're busy, GoHighLevel can instantly text them, acknowledging the missed call and providing next steps. Test this scenario during your trial. If it doesn't fit, cancel before day 14 without charge.

How to Evaluate GoHighLevel Honestly for Your Business
Before committing, ask yourself these three critical questions to determine if GoHighLevel is right for your business:
Do you have a system that automatically follows up with every missed call within 60 seconds? If not, you have a gaping hole in your lead management. GoHighLevel's Missed Call Text Back and automated workflows plug this. For instance, a busy chiropractic office can instantly text a missed new patient call, apologizing and offering an online booking link, dramatically increasing lead capture.
Are you paying for more than two tools in our 'What GoHighLevel Replaces' table? If your current software stack includes separate CRM, email, SMS, scheduling, and reputation management tools, you're likely overpaying and creating complexity. GoHighLevel consolidates these, offering substantial cost savings and invaluable efficiency gains from a unified platform.
Can you dedicate 3-5 hours for initial setup and optimization? GoHighLevel is powerful but not plug-and-play. Initial configuration (phone numbers, calendar integration, workflows) requires time. If you can't commit, factor in a one-time setup service (typically $200–$500 from certified partners) to ensure a strong start and maximize ROI. Don't buy the Ferrari if you won't learn to drive it.
